Taylor Swift reportedly declined to perform at King Charles III’s coronation ceremony in May.
King Charles III, 75, reportedly had a list of musicians who declined to perform at his highly-anticipated coronation ceremony in May. One of those singers includes Taylor Swift, 33, as revealed in royal expert Omid Scobie‘s new book, Endgame. Although the reason that the Grammy winner opted out of performing for His Majesty this spring remains unknown, the dates did fall during her Eras Tour.
At the time, Taylor was performing three concerts in Nashville, Tennessee, as reported by US Weekly. Charles’ official coronation took place on May 6, which was night two of Taylor’s weekend in Nashville. The author noted that it was “a challenge” to secure a performer for the coronation, as many other artists declined the invitation and request to perform.
